🌼 What Defines a “Cozy Game”?
You might be wondering: what even is a cozy game? Is it just a game with cute characters? Not quite.
Cozy games are all about low stakes, slow pacing, and emotional warmth. They rarely include violence, time pressure, or harsh consequences. Instead, they focus on things like:
- Farming
- Fishing
- Crafting
- Storytelling
- Exploration
- Friendship-building
- Decorating and customizing
It’s not about “winning” — it’s about being. Whether you’re decorating a cabin in the woods or running a tiny coffee shop, cozy games let you relax and express yourself.
Art style plays a big role too. Think hand-drawn aesthetics, soft pastels, or dreamy pixel art. Music? Chill lo-fi beats or acoustic guitar strums. Every element is designed to be calming and joyful.
🧠 Mental Health Benefits of Playing Cozy Games
Let’s get real for a second—cozy games aren’t just fun. They’re healing. More people in 2025 are turning to cozy titles as a form of self-care and emotional regulation. And honestly, it works.
Here’s why:
- Reduces Anxiety: The slow pace and soothing visuals help calm the nervous system.
- Builds Routine: Games like Stardew Valley or Animal Crossing let you create daily rituals that feel safe and familiar.
- Boosts Mood: Bright colors, uplifting music, and wholesome characters naturally lift spirits.
- Safe Exploration: Players can explore social situations, emotions, and creativity in a safe, non-judgmental space.
- Encourages Mindfulness: Harvesting crops or fishing in a quiet stream can be oddly meditative.
These games become a gentle anchor—something you can always return to when the world feels like too much.

🌊 Coral Island
If Stardew Valley had a tropical cousin, it’d be Coral Island. This game exploded in popularity thanks to its environmental themes, diverse characters, and deep farming mechanics.
2025 updates added coral reef restoration missions, underwater farming, and even new romance arcs. The art style is lush, and the pacing is wonderfully slow. Great for players who want a farming sim with a purpose.
Why it’s cozy:
- Gorgeous tropical visuals
- Inclusive character creation
- Environmental storylines
- Relaxing farming, mining, and diving
🍵 Spirittea
Think Spirited Away meets Stardew Valley. In Spirittea, you run a bathhouse for troubled spirits. The story is heartfelt, the gameplay is light, and the characters are deeply memorable.
There’s something really magical about tending to spirit guests, brewing tea, and decorating your bathhouse with love and intention. It’s spiritual self-care in pixel form.
Why it’s cozy:
- Mystical, calming atmosphere
- Wholesome narrative and themes
- Easy-going daily management
- Memorable characters and quests

🌽 Farming Sim Hybrids
The cozy genre and farming games have always been close cousins. But in 2025, farming sim hybrids are dominating the scene. We’re not just planting carrots and feeding chickens anymore. These games blend agriculture with deep narrative experiences, fantasy elements, and even light puzzle mechanics.
Think about it—farming in a fantasy village populated by talking animals? Or raising crops that affect the storyline? Titles like Moonleaf Valley and Sunhaven 2 do exactly this, giving players cozy gameplay layered with unique twists.
Why we love it:
- It adds depth without ruining the chill vibe.
- Farming gives a satisfying loop of progress.
- Perfect blend of structure and freedom.
These hybrids manage to keep gameplay fresh while holding onto that heartwarming, no-pressure tone we love.

❓ FAQs About Cozy Games in 2025
Q1: What’s the best free cozy game?
A: Kind Words (lo fi chill beats to write to) is still one of the best free cozy experiences. It’s emotionally uplifting, safe, and has a strong online community focused on kindness.
Q2: Can cozy games be played offline?
A: Absolutely! Many cozy games like Stardew Valley, A Short Hike, and Unpacking offer full offline modes, perfect for when you want to disconnect completely.
Q3: Are cozy games good for kids?
A: 100%! Most cozy games are family-friendly, with themes of kindness, creativity, and exploration. Titles like Animal Crossing and Garden Paws are great for younger players.
Q4: Do cozy games have storylines?
A: Many do, yes. While not all cozy games are narrative-driven, games like Spirittea, Lake, and To The Moon incorporate emotional, slow-paced stories that enhance the cozy vibe.
Q5: Which cozy game should I start with?
A: If you’re new, try Stardew Valley. It’s a great introduction to cozy mechanics—farming, fishing, befriending townsfolk—and it’s available on almost every platform.
